Mumbai: Pharma major Cipla has posted a 17 per cent jump in its net profit to Rs 140 crore for the first quarter of financial year 2008-09 compared with Rs 119.76 crore in the corresponding quarter last financial year, due to higher sales. The company's total sales has also gone up by 34 per cent to Rs 1224.1 crore for the quarter ended June 2008 compared with Rs 911.8 crore the company posted in the first quarter of last financial year. The company has recommended payment of dividend of Rs 2 per equity share for the financial year 2008 amounting to Rs 156.46 crore.

Kirloskar Brothers slips into the red

Mumbai: Kirloskar Brothers, a maker of pumps and valves, has reported a loss of Rs 4.4 crore in the three months ended June 2008 compared with a net income of Rs 25.71 crore a year ago, as expense climbed by about a third. Sales rose 16 per cent.

Gujarat NRE Coke net up two-fold

Mumbai: Low-ash metallurgical coke manufacturer Gujarat NRE Coke has posted a net profit of Rs 94.4 crore for the quarter ended June 30, more than two-fold rise over the corresponding period last year. Total income for the latest quarter stood at Rs 382.12 crore as against Rs 152.38 crore in the same period last year.

GE Shipping profit declines 8%

Mumbai: Great Eastern Shipping has announced a net profit of Rs 387.59 crore for the first quarter ended June 2008, a 7.94 per cent decline over the corresponding period last year. The total income rose to Rs 992.49 crore in the latest quarter, from Rs 754.32 crore in the same period a year-ago.
